HS girls soccer: Cy-Fair crushes Cy Springs
Cy-Fair registered an 11-0 win over Cy Springs in District 17-5A high school girls soccer action on Tuesday.
Hannah Dauzat scored three goals to lead her team to victory.
The win ups Cy-Fair to 15-1-3 overall and 11-0-1 in district play.
Mallory Majewski and Laura McGee teamed on the shutout in net.
Cy-Fair will next visit Cy Creek on Friday at 7 p.m.
The loss drops Cy Springs to 1-15-0 overall and 0-11-0 in district play.
Cy Springs will next visit Cy Ridge on Friday at 7 p.m.
